Thundersley and South Benfleet has 230 food establishments with an average hygiene rating of 4.8 out of 5, which is above the national average of 4.6.
96% of rated establishments hold a rating of 4 or above, with 89% achieving the top rating of 5.
Among business types, school/college/university establishments lead the way with an average rating of 5 across 21 inspected premises.
Restaurant/Cafe/Canteen is the most common category, accounting for 25% of food businesses in Thundersley and South Benfleet.
25 establishments have been inspected in the last 90 days.

There are currently 230 food businesses with hygiene ratings in Thundersley and South Benfleet, out of 606,166 rated establishments across the UK.
In Thundersley and South Benfleet, the average hygiene rating is 4.8/5 — above the national average of 4.6/5. 89% of rated businesses in Thundersley and South Benfleet hold the highest rating of 5.
Food hygiene inspections in Thundersley and South Benfleet are carried out by Castle Point. Inspectors assess how hygienically food is handled, the physical condition of the premises, and how well the business manages food safety procedures.
Ratings follow the Food Hygiene Rating Scheme (FHRS), scoring businesses from 0 (urgent improvement necessary) to 5 (very good). Ratings are updated following inspections and may change over time. Data for Thundersley and South Benfleet was last updated on 6 April 2026.
